利用纳米技术研制纳米管阵列天线的可能性

摘    要:在分析传统天线工作机理的基础上,基于纳米物理原理,本文提出了利用纳米管研究纳米管阵列天线的概念.由于纳米管内电子运动固有的弹道输运效应,使得纳米管阵列天线具有辐射效率高的优点.同时,由于纳米管阵列不受趋肤效应影响,在口径面及空间内按一定规律布排纳米管阵列,并形成需要的电流分布,可进一步提高纳米管阵列天线的辐射增益.计算表明,除具有辐射效率高以外,纳米管阵列天线的辐射方向性优于相同表面积上的微带天线.本文同时对纳米管阵列天线可能的馈电方式进行了探讨.

The Possibility of Designing Nano-Tube Array Antenna with Nano-Technology

Abstract:Based on the analysis of traditional antennas and nano-physics,the concept of design of antennas with nano-tube array is proposed here.The intrinsic ballistic transportation of electrons in nano-tube makes it possible for antennas consisting of nano-tube array to radiate with higher efficiency.Meanwhile,because there is no skin effect among nano-tubes,required current distribution can be achieved by arranging nano-tubes in a giving aperture and space,thus the gain of present antenna can be further enhanced.Calculation results indicate that,except for the high efficiency,directivity of nano-tube array is better than traditional microstrip antenna with the same area.Possible feed method of nano-tube array is also discussed.
